Does anyone in here know if there is a way to let new POLYGON function
(or similar) in IDL8 produce polygons overlays filled with texture
patterns. Or more precisely, filled with warped images like the old
POLYFILL procedure.

I have started to transfer my GUI routines from direct graphics to the
new Graphics system, and suddenly my whole application lost that
authentic 1994 look and feel. And I guess, by the time I finish, the
user friendlyness should have increased by an order of magnitude. :)

Please tell me that I do not have to teach my self the "old" object
graphics stuff, and write everything from scratch.
